A very interesting team principal press conference followed the second practice session ahead of the Canadian Grand Prix today. Most notably, Ross Brawn revealed that it was him who made the decision to go ahead with the controversial Pirelli tyre testing in Barcelona following the Spanish Grand Prix. Fernando Alonso just pipped Lewis Hamilton to go fastest in FP2 ahead of the Canadian Grand Prix. Alonso’s Ferrari finished the session just 0.012 seconds ahead of Hamilton with a time of 1:14:818. Force India’s Paul Di Resta was the surprise of the First Free Practice session at the Canadian GP. Di Resta finished top of the time sheets with a 1:21.020 ahead of McLaren’s Jenson Button who was 0.088s off his pace with a 1:21.108.
